What should be done before buying props
Whatever tool you choose, you must know:
What is the material to be processed? What machine is used for machining? Finish machining or rough machining? Is there any drawing requirements? What is the pressing method? How much is the cutting edge? The blade model?
1、 External turning tool:
What is the required main deflection angle of the tool? Is there any drawing requirement? What is the material to be processed? Is there any hardness requirement?
2、 Inner hole turning tool:
How big is the diameter? How deep is the hole? How big is the inner diameter of the tool sleeve? Is there any interference in the inner hole?
3、 Grooving knife:
What is the cutting depth? What is the groove width? Is it the outer round groove or the inner hole groove cutter? What is the machining diameter and machining diameter? (special question of the end groove cutter)
4、 Cutter:
What is the cutting diameter? What is the required slot width?
5、 Thread turning tool:
Front and back hand of thread turning tool? External thread or internal thread? Metric system or British system? What is the pitch?

Milling cutters: (taking machining as an example)

1. Bit clamping type:
Elastic collet type or three jaw centering type? How large is the tool installed? How much is the ER?
What is the handle size of taper handle? What is the length?
2. Clamping milling cutters:
What is the size of the milling cutter to be clamped? Standard or high-speed?
What is the size of taper shank? What is the size of threaded hole?
3. Installation of thread taps:
Rigid tapping or flexible tapping required? What size tap?
4. Clamping surface milling cutter head type:
What is the diameter of the cutterhead? What is the internal circle of the cutterhead? Is there a length requirement for metric or English holes?
5. Boring cutter:
a. Rough boring cutter
Module type or integrated type? What is the required processing range? Processing length? Is extension bar required?
b. Fine boring cutter
Modular or integrated? What is the machining precision? What is the machining length? Is it required to add extension bar and machining range?
6. Tool setting instrument:
Should we use the meter or digital display or projection? What is the measurement range? What is the measurement accuracy?
Tools
1、 Milling cutter:
1. Integral milling cutter
Is the end milling cutter made of high speed steel or hard alloy? What is the hardness of processing? What is the length requirement? How many blades? Ball head or flat head? How many degrees is the shank? What is the thread? What kind of coating? How many degrees is the helix rising angle?
2. Blade type milling cutter
1) Spindle type milling cutter
What is the required diameter? Is there any requirement for blade angle? How long is the machining length?
2) Cutter head;
What is the diameter? What is the angle of the blade required? Is it required to finish or rough? Is it required to clean the angle of the tool?
2、 Bit:
1) Straight shank drill
Is the drill required to be high-speed rigid or hard alloy? What is the machining diameter? What is the machining? Is there any requirement for the cutting edge?
2) Taper shank bit
What is the original tool sleeve? What is the machining diameter? What is the machining requirement? Is there any requirement for the cutting edge?
3、 Taps:
1) Screw tap
Do you want a left-hand or right-hand tap? What is the required thread size? Is it metric or British? What is the processing accuracy? What is the material to be processed? What is the national standard for the handle?
2) Straight slot tap
What is the material of processing? Hand attack or machine attack?
4、 Chamfering tool:
What is the range of chamfer required? What is the angle?
5、 Reamer:
1) Straight shank reamer
What is the machining? What is the machining precision? What is the machining diameter?
2) Taper shank reamer
What is the original taper sleeve? What is the processing? What is the processing precision? What is the processing diameter?
